Package org.apache.sysds.runtime.util
Class AutoDiff
- java.lang.Object
 - 
- org.apache.sysds.runtime.util.AutoDiff
 
 
- 
public class AutoDiff extends Object
 
- 
- 
Constructor Summary
Constructors Constructor Description AutoDiff() 
- 
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static ArrayList<Hop>constructHopsNR(LineageItem item, Map<Long,Hop> operands, Hop mo, ArrayList<String> names)static ListObjectgetBackward(MatrixObject mo, ArrayList<Data> lineage, ExecutionContext adec)static List<Data>parseNComputeAutoDiffFromLineage(MatrixObject mo, String mainTrace, ArrayList<String> names, ExecutionContext ec) 
 - 
 
- 
- 
Method Detail
- 
getBackward
public static ListObject getBackward(MatrixObject mo, ArrayList<Data> lineage, ExecutionContext adec)
 
- 
parseNComputeAutoDiffFromLineage
public static List<Data> parseNComputeAutoDiffFromLineage(MatrixObject mo, String mainTrace, ArrayList<String> names, ExecutionContext ec)
 
 - 
 
 -